Which physical mechanism could explain the fact that the atmospheric concentration of CO2 varies slightly over the course of each year?
A) Major volcanic eruptions every decade or so place additional CO2 in the atmosphere.
B) Every few years, another huge coal-powered power plant opens up and produces more CO2.
C) Seasonal changes in plant growth produce a regular yearly variation in CO2 levels, with the Northern Hemisphere (with much more land area) causing almost all the variation.
